Je plonge dans le monde fascinant de l'analyse par éléments finis et je voudrais résoudre un gros problème thermo-mécanique (uniquement thermique mécanique à , pas de feedback).
Pour le problème mécanique, j'ai déjà compris de la réponse de Geoff , que je devrai utiliser un solveur itératif en raison de la taille de ma maille. J'ai également lu dans la réponse de Matt que le choix de l'algorithme itératif correct est une tâche intimidante.
Je demande ici s'il existe une expérience sur de gros problèmes linéaires-élastiques en 3D qui pourrait m'aider à affiner ma recherche des meilleures performances? Dans mon cas, c'est une structure avec des films minces à motifs et des matériaux placés de manière irrégulière (à la fois CTE élevé et CTE faible). Il n'y a pas de grandes déformations dans cette analyse thermo-mécanique. Je peux utiliser le HPC de mon université [1,314 nœuds, avec 2 processeurs AMD Opteron (chacun 2,2 GHz / 8 cœurs)].
Je pense que cela PETSc
pourrait contenir quelque chose d'intéressant, en particulier les algorithmes qui font une sorte de décomposition de domaine (FETI, multigrid) mais je suis un peu dépassé par les options et je n'ai aucune expérience. J'aime aussi l'expression «préconditionneurs géométriquement informés» , mais je ne sais pas si cela m'aide. Je n'ai pas encore trouvé quelque chose qui se concentre sur la mécanique du continuum linéaire.
Une mise à l'échelle forte (Amdahl) est très importante dans mon application car mes partenaires industriels ne peuvent pas attendre longtemps les résultats de la simulation. J'apprécie certainement non seulement les réponses, mais aussi les recommandations pour une lecture plus approfondie dans les commentaires.